Fabege is a property company specializing in urban development and the management of commercial properties, with a focus on select submarkets in the Stockholm area. The company develops, owns, and manages a portfolio of modern offices, retail spaces, and flexible workspace solutions, including coworking environments. Its core strategy involves creating attractive, safe, and sustainable city districts. Fabege designs offices and meeting spaces intended to support diverse work styles, enhance corporate culture, and facilitate value creation for its tenants. The company maintains a strong commitment to sustainability, emphasizing energy efficiency and circular economy principles in its operations.
